An Appraisal for Insurance Purposes
One of the most common reasons that someone will get an appraisal on their jewelry is for insurance purposes. Whether you are insuring your jewelry against a home invasion or some kind of disaster, the insurance company is going to need to know how much your jewelry is worth. They will need certification and documents from an accredited appraiser for any kind of jewelry that is going to be insured under your new policy, and they are not just going to take your word for it when it comes to value.
Check to See if a Diamond is Real
There are many sophisticated methods of creating false diamonds these days, so sometimes it makes sense to double check the diamonds that you own to see if they are real. Even if you purchased your diamonds or other jewelry from an accredited dealer, it never hurts to get an opinion from a third party. The fact of the matter is that you never really know if a diamond is real until it has been checked for authenticity and given a value.
The Need for Some Fast Cash
Life is full of ups and down, and there are going to be some instances in most people's lives where owning fine jewelry is not very practical. It always makes sense to get an appraisal on your jewelry before you sell it because you cannot put a price on jewelry if you do not know how much it is worth. If you do not know the value of the jewelry that you are trying to sell, then you are basically guaranteed to get ripped off at the end of the day.
